调用SendDryRunSystemEvent接口触发一个用于调试的系统事件。

此API用于调试事件下游配置的触发逻辑是否符合预期,即通过调用此API可以发送一条测试事件,帮助用户验证对应的事件触发报警后返回的内容是否符合预期。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String SendDryRunSystemEvent

系统规定参数。取值:SendDryRunSystemEvent。

EventName String Agent_Status_Stopped

事件名称。

说明 关于事件名称的取值,请参见DescribeSystemEventMetaList
Product String CloudMonitor

产品的名称缩写。

说明 关于产品名称缩写的取值,请参见DescribeSystemEventMetaList
EventContent String {"product":"CloudMonitor","resourceId":"acs:ecs:cn-hongkong:173651113438****:instance/{instanceId}","level":"CRITICAL","instanceName":"instanceName","regionId":"cn-hangzhou","name":"Agent_Status_Stopped","content":{"ipGroup":"0.0.0.0,0.0.0.1","tianjimonVersion":"1.2.11"},"status":"stopped"}

事件内容。此处为模拟触发指定事件发送的内容。

说明 该参数的取值可以为任意一个合法的JSON,我们建议JSON中包含productresourceIdregionId几个关键值。
GroupId String 12345

应用分组ID。

返回数据

名称 类型 示例值 描述
RequestId String 486029C9-53E1-44B4-85A8-16A571A043FD

请求ID。

Success String true

请求是否成功。

Code String 200

状态码。

说明 状态码为200表示成功。
Message String success

错误信息。

示例

请求示例


http(s)://[Endpoint]/?Action=SendDryRunSystemEvent
&EventName=Agent_Status_Stopped
&Product=CloudMonitor
&<公共请求参数>

正常返回示例

XML 格式

<Message>success</Message>
<RequestId>590FB642-5FFE-4AE0-883B-E1323DD20541</RequestId>
<Code>200</Code>
<Success>true</Success>

JSON 格式

{
	"Message":"success",
	"RequestId":"590FB642-5FFE-4AE0-883B-E1323DD20541",
	"Success":true,
	"Code":"200"
}

错误码

访问错误中心查看更多错误码。